Default Guidance needed for Islamiat

Guys can someone help me out on how to prepare for Islamiat. We know that alot of candidates failed in Islamiat 2010 paper so I am putting special emphasis and focus on this subject. At the moment I am preparing from

1)Advanced Concepts in Islamic Studies by Imtiaz Shahid
2)Islamiat By Farkhanda Noor (The O Levels book)

I also have notes of Officers Academy but they are depressingly, illegible

My questions are

1)Are these books sufficient for preparation? If not, please recommend some
2)Please also recommend any book/other source for MCQs of Islamiat
3)Please guide on how to attempt the question and what style should one adopt. What should be the main crux of our answers and what sort of supporting material we can use to get maximum marks.

Apart from this, I would also highly appreciate any other tips etc.

helo dear , as u ask about how to attempt the question as i have experience in 2010 i got 48 marks in islamiat.brother when q ask abt present problems first u put present scenario and then discus their causes and in last u give some suggestion that was my way of giving answers so dont worry and only adopt one book plz

Hi Mani! I am one of the candidates who managed to fail themselves in Islamyat. The clear reason for my failure was the wrong attempt of two of the questions. You must understand it's a very easy paper but you need to apply a little common sense. My sole advice will be to have a clear understanding of the question and do have an outline before attempting it. I managed to lose the plot of outline while attempting two questions that's why I got 34 in it.

AOA mani,
I was also failed in Islamiat by scoring 37 I attempted in urdu.
My best advice to u dont depend on notes of any academy, they have insufficient & limited knowldge, but after my exmas i find a book "Islamiat (jadeed Tanazur Main) " by Bhatti sons, i find this book knowldgeable, composed & according to the questions.
Best thing of this book is this that it has solved past paper questions.
I consult this year but unfortunately due tou some reasons, i m missed my las chance.
anyway try this book & dont forget to consult Friday editions of top Newspapers.
